Releases: sensorsdata/sa-sdk-android-plugin2
Releases · sensorsdata/sa-sdk-android-plugin2
Release 3.2.5
-
新增
- 支持
React Native可视化全埋点
- 支持
-
修复
- 文件流未关闭,引起编译时
Too many open files的问题
- 文件流未关闭,引起编译时
Release 3.2.4
-
修复
URLClassLoader未关闭可能引起的编译报错问题HookonNavigationItemSeletecd回调不支持AndroidX的问题- 扫描
jar可能出现的命名重复问题 HookRadioGroup控件可能出现的参数优化问题
-
新增
- 插件一键开启
App与H5打通,注意需要配合 Android SDK v4.0.8 及以上版本使用,使用方式参见帮助文档
- 插件一键开启
Release 3.2.1
- 优化
- 插件对
React Native全埋点的支持,埋点采集更精确。如果是React Native项目,请参照 神策React Native集成文档升级sensorsdata-analytics-react-native插件到2.0.0及以上版本配合使用。
- 插件对
Release 3.2.0
-
修复
- 插件处理第三方
JAR可能会抛出java.util.zip.ZipException异常,导致插件编译停止的问题
- 插件处理第三方
-
优化
- 插件
disableIMEI = true配置对Android SDK v3.2.9版本的适配 - 日志信息的打印,在日志中提供对外支持
QQ号码(785122381)
- 插件
Release 3.1.9
-
修复
- 在
Fragment生命周期函数上添加SensorsDataIgnoreTrackOnClick注解导致Fragment的$AppViewScreen无法采集的问题
- 在
-
新增
- 支持
PopupMenu的$AppClick事件采集 - 支持在方法前进行
Hook代码,默认仍在方法后进行Hook代码
- 支持
Release 3.1.8
-
修复
- 修复
HookFragmentonVewCreated方法导致的crash问题
- 修复
-
新增
- 新增
$AppClick支持ToolBar的MenuItem点击; - 新增
$AppClick支持ActionBarDrawerToggle点击。
- 新增
-
优化
- 优化
TabLayout嵌套ViewPager的点击事件($AppClick)采集。
- 优化
Release 3.1.5
-
修复
· 修复编译期间可能会出现java.lang.ArrayIndexOutOfBoundsException的问题。 -
优化
· 优化扫描文件时,规避目录名可能包含.class的特殊情况;
· 部分常量统一管理。
Release 3.1.4
- 优化
· 支持Java 9模块化(visitModule)
Release 3.1.3
-
新增
·$AppClick支持android/content/DialogInterface$OnMultiChoiceClickListener -
修复
· 修复编译目录时没有启用并发编译的问题 -
优化
· 优化Transform输出目录名,输出易阅读的__content__.json文件
· 处理Jar时,统一使用JarEntry对象(之前部分使用 ZipEntry)
Release 3.1.2
【修复】
Lambda在特定条件下编译失败的问题FragmentsetUserVisibleHint方法参数被优化后可能会编译失败的问题